利用科学测绘技术绘制的近代地图作为一类珍贵的历史地理资料,不同程度上反映着过去的地表覆盖情况,数字化则是复原地图所载地表覆盖信息的重要途径。以《华东·上海》地图为例,实现并验证一种基于机器学习和图像形态学的彩色近代地图数字化方法。结果表明,该方法能够充分挖掘地图中的颜色信息和形态结构信息,以半自动方式快速准确地将彩色近代地图中的地表水体信息提取出来。该方法对数字化一类彩色近代地图具有参考价值,有望为精准复原近代以来地表覆盖变迁,深入理解人地关系变化提供数据和方法基础。  相似文献

Publicly available LiDAR (Light Detection and Ranging) data provide a potential windfall for archaeologists, permitting the creation of detailed topographic site maps with little more than an internet-connected computer and appropriate software. The quality of these LiDAR data for site mapping is variable, however, and may need to be supplemented with data obtained from conventional mapping techniques. We share insights from recent mapping of the Fort Center site (8GL13) in southern Florida. Specifically, we suggest a method—based on trial and error—for integrating LiDAR and total station survey data. We compare the results of our work with previous efforts at mapping the site based solely on conventional archaeological survey methods, as well as with results based on LiDAR data alone. We conclude that our combination of LiDAR data, corrected by conventional survey data, produces the most accurate map.  相似文献

Maps and mapping are fundamental to archaeology. Archaeologists sometimes fail to recognize that the maps we use and create are fraught, like material culture, with interpretive complexities. These complexities arise from the fact that maps are created with social meaning dependent on the context in which the map was created and used. Here, we relate our experience with maps and mapmaking at the pithouse settlement of Sxxwiymelh, in southwestern British Columbia. We review the mapping history of the site, highlighting the contexts in which the maps were constructed and how they influenced subsequent interpretations of the site. We describe our deconstruction of these earlier maps and how we combined them to create a more accurate and detailed map that presented a rendition of the site as it was prior to significant modern development. This process of map deconstruction and construction allowed us to see several previously unknown details about the ancient settlement (e.g., house form, relative house size, and feature spacing) of Sxxwiymelh. In general, this process provides conceptual and practical lessons for incorporating previously collected map data into archaeological research.  相似文献

This report of the Permanent Commission on Landscape Maps of the Geographical Society USSR defines four groups of landscape maps and their basic mapped objects, ranging from detailed, large-scale facies maps (1:10,000) to small-scale maps of less than 1:1,000,000 showing mainly landscapes (in the sense of a given rank of natural areal unit). The report defines various physical-geographic units, such as facies, urochishche and mestnost' and the Russian terms have been retained where the meaning is ambiguous and there is no clear-cut English equivalent. The report also discusses various ways of formulating map legends. A previous paper on landscape mapping appeared in Soviet Geography, February 1961, pp. 34–47.  相似文献

Irrigated agriculture was central to the economies of many of the world’s best known complex societies. New high-resolution digital elevation models (DEM) derived from remotely sensed lidar data give archaeologists the opportunity to study field systems at a scale not previously possible. Here we describe a method called slope contrast mapping that takes advantage of the dissimilarity between artificial and natural slopes to identify and map discrete features. We use this relatively simple method in our own research to identify complexes of agricultural terraces in the North Kohala district, Hawai’i Island. It has also proved useful for mapping the natural landscape, specifically the extent of flat land between valleys suited for irrigated agriculture.  相似文献

Advances in remote sensing and space-based imaging have led to an increased understanding of past settlements and landscape use, but – until now – the images in tropical regions have not been detailed enough to provide datasets that permitted the computation of digital elevation models for heavily forested and hilly terrain. The application of airborne LiDAR (light detection and ranging) remote sensing provides a detailed raster image that mimics a 3-D view (technically, it is 2.5-D) of a 200 sq km area covering the settlement of Caracol, a long-term occupied (600 BC-A.D. 250–900) Maya archaeological site in Belize, literally “seeing” though gaps in the rainforest canopy. Penetrating the encompassing jungle, LiDAR-derived images accurately portray not only the topography of the landscape, but also, structures, causeways, and agricultural terraces – even those with relatively low relief of 5–30 cm. These data demonstrate the ability of the ancient Maya to modify, radically, their landscape in order to create a sustainable urban environment. Given the time and intensive effort involved in producing traditional large-scale maps, swath mapping LiDAR is a powerful cost-efficient tool to analyze past settlement and landscape modifications in tropical regions as it covers large study areas in a relatively short time. The use of LiDAR technology, as illustrated here, will ultimately replace traditional settlement mapping in tropical rainforest environments, such as the Maya region, although ground verification will continue to be necessary to test its efficacy.  相似文献

Digital analysis of Landsat data is applied to up-dating land cover maps for the Goondiwindi district of southern, inland Queensland. The imagery was paired with climax cover maps obtained from land systems reports with analysis conducted separately for each of three climax cover types (open forest, woodland and open woodland). Computer classification using this approach produced readily interpreted and reliable results. This work demonstrates that Landsat can be used in conjunction with existing, land systems derived maps to produce data that combine the advantages of two approaches to environmental survey, the former being based on current land cover/land use and the latter on the original environment and its land use potential.  相似文献

Given Australia's dispersed population distribution the construction and maintenance of transportation infrastructure is both essential and expensive. This paper presents a simple model for assessing geotechnical suitability for road construction across the continent, based upon the three major phases of road construction: earthworks, pavement construction and sealing. Data from the recently completed geotechnical landscape map of Australia have been used to operationalise the model at a national scale. The map was coded to the basic spatial units (modified local government areas) of the Australian Resources Information System, so forming an extensive geographic data base suited to a variety of national transport suitability assessments. As a demonstration, the road construction suitability model and the geotechnical data have been applied to the task of mapping the average suitability of each basic spatal unit in Australia for each of the three phases of road construction. The resulting maps provide a comprehensive overview of the instrinsic difficulty of providing roading throughout Australia.  相似文献

Landscape science, as a discipline concerned with the integrated investigation of natural areal complexes of different ranks, has been gaining an increasing range of practical applications in connection with optimal design of cultural landscapes. The paper focuses on the use of applied landscape maps in investigations designed to make optimal use of the ecological potential of natural landscapes and their morphological subdivisions. Five types of maps are distinguished, corresponding to successive stages in the investigation. An inventory map presents a picture of the present state of the natural complexes, with emphasis on those features that are most relevant to the stated applied purpose (recreational use, agricultural use, engineering applications, etc.). An evaluative map classifies the natural complexes in terms of their suitability for the stated purpose. A predictive map focuses on the likely future behavior of these complexes, and a recommendatory map lists measures required to enhance the potential of natural areas for particular purposes. The ultimate result is a synthesized map of the entire proposed cultural landscape.  相似文献

The confrontation outside London (7 February 1554) between the rebel army of Sir Thomas Wyatt and forces loyal to Queen Mary Tudor has been frequently characterized as a bloodless contest of will rather than a military conflict. This view, however, fails to account for the action’s wider significance in the study of Tudor warfare, a field arguably distorted by the limited number of battles fought within the sixteenth-century British Isles. Furthermore, the encounter is unusually well-documented by written narratives, while its location ensures that the battlefield is depicted on several near-contemporary and subsequent maps, providing opportunities for more detailed investigation through terrain reconstruction. This article will use methodologies of map regression to define the historic landscape of the battle, permitting tactical-level consideration of the engagement and helping to discern the site’s archaeological potential. By doing so, it will also facilitate a reassessment of the battle’s key events and implications.  相似文献

Uplands have long been considered important ‘barometers’ for human-environment relationships. Five pollen sequences from the upper Aber Valley (Snowdonia), across an altitudinal gradient, reveal that human impacts have varied temporally on small spatial scales in the region. Woodland taxa persisted into the later Holocene at lower altitudes and sites located at higher altitude reveal a more open landscape history, possibly as a result of increased exposure limiting tree growth at high elevation. Continuous pastoral human land use is evident in the high upland (400 to >600 m AOD) landscape with evidence of clearing, burning and grazing indicators throughout the records covering the last ~6000 years, with increased activity apparent during the last 2000 years. There is no clear evidence to suggest that climate change (e.g. deteriorating climatic conditions from ~850 BC) resulted in land abandonment and it appears more likely that climatic shifts could have led to changes in human land management. The results demonstrate that pastoral land use varied at different altitudes across the Aber Valley upland, and have highlighted the value and potential of high/fine spatial sampling in providing insights into land use history and the mosaic of habitats that result.  相似文献

This article explores the use of Story Maps in a cultural geography field course that uses a place-based approach to understand the Delta Blue’s culture. In this study, Story Maps was used to capture and map student experiences as they engaged in a field study. Student experiences are captured by incorporating different data mediums such as narratives, personal reflections, digital photos, videos and website. Such a project has the potential to challenge students to work collectively and present a coherent story of their field experiences. This, in turn, can be used to improve the design and experience of a field course. The study demonstrates that the availability of simple web-based mapping platform such as Story maps provides students the ability to harness technology to create geocoded narratives, visual representations and spatial documentation to map their field course experience.  相似文献

The landscape around the prehistoric Peruvian ceremonial center of Chavín de Huántar has undergone extensive geomorphic and anthropogenic change since the beginning of monumental construction at the site in approximately 1200 BCE. Archaeological and geomorphic stratigraphy from the site and its near periphery provide the data necessary to characterize these changes in detail. This paper reports on the use of GIS-based interpolation tools to approximate a complex prehistoric land surface using unevenly scattered point data. Such an interpolated surface serves as the basis for the reconstruction of the pre-Chavín landscape and assessment of landscape change contemporary with the site.  相似文献

Recent developments in the Soviet Union's program of national thematic mapping and regional complex mapping are reviewed. A comprehensive mapping program along these lines, formulated in 1969 by GUGK, the government planning agency, has not been implemented. National thematic maps in the Soviet Union continue to be compiled by individual government agencies without coordination and without uniformity in legend and design, so that comparability is made difficult. The only thematic GUGK maps now being prepared are concerned with two long-term regional development programs in the Soviet Union–the rural development plan for the Nonchernozem zone of the European RSFSR and the construction of the Baykal-Amur Mainline (BAM) railroad in the Soviet Far East. The need for a comprehensive and coordinated program of national thematic maps and regional atlases or map series is once again stressed in connection with economic planning and environmental problems, and a program of continuously updated regional atlases, based on digital data banks, is proposed. Suggestions are also made for the coordination of thematic maps at the international level.  相似文献

This paper examines the politics of land and forest rights in Kalimantan (Indonesian Borneo). Forest mapping by government forestry planners allocates rights of resource use and land access according to forest types and economic objectives, only rarely recognizing indigenous occupancy rights or forest territories customarily claimed or managed by local people. As maps and official plans based on them ignore, and in some cases criminalize, traditional rights to forest, forest products, and forest land for temporary conversion to swidden agriculture, indigenous activists are using sketch maps to re-claim territories - a process that requires re-defining many traditional forest rights. The paper considers the political implications of mapping and the implications of a focus on land use rather than forest use.  相似文献

The focus in this article is on the way the post eighteenth-century cartographic turn in military practices developed into a particular military perception of landscape that continues to set the standard of Danish topographical mapping. My argument is that the development of modern topographical maps is the result of a long process of military comprehension and measurement of the terrain in order to conduct field operations. The demand for spatial data for actual or potential military operations had a direct impact on the specifications of maps produced by the military, as landscape representation was adapted to meet operational demands and as lessons learned from war experience were incorporated. In this and other respects, the development of Danish topographical maps in and after the nineteenth century followed the general trend of European military mapping as regards methods and standards.  相似文献

既要保留遗迹在不同阶段的信息资料,又不影响发掘研究工作的继续进行,一直是考古工作者探索研究的问题。为配合秦始皇陵百戏俑坑的考古发掘工作,为后续考古研究和文物遗迹的保护提供必要的基础信息资料,针对大场景考古发掘现场,通过数字全站仪对文物挖掘现场布设的一定数量控制点进行观测获取其三维点位坐标。利用非量测数码相机获取现场多航带序列影像,通过数码相机检校、自动空中三角测量、影像特征提取与影像匹配、数字微分纠正等数字近景摄影测量方法,获取反映发掘现场文物分布情况的数字高程模型(DEM)和正射影像(DOM)数据。在生成的正射影像图上进行文物轮廓线条的提取,获得发掘现场文物的正射投影矢量图。实现文物位置、形状及分布的平面量测。实验证明:该方法不仅可大面积、快速获取文物挖掘现场文物分布的正射投影平面图,实现考古数字制图,而且能保证一定的精度。具有较高的推广应用价值。  相似文献

A digital elevation model and a topographic map of an archaeological site in Syria were created from a field topographic survey with a handheld laser range finder and data post‐processing using a notebook personal computer with Geographical Information System software. The method enabled rapid on‐site topographical mapping even under technical and political restrictions in the country. In an area of about 1 km2, coordinates of random points on the land surface were measured, and a DEM with a 10 m interval grid was generated from the point cloud using Kriging interpolation. The DEM enables various topographic representations to be constructed, such as contour lines, cross sections and slope distribution maps. The DEM‐derived contour lines with a 1 m interval were combined with vector data showing roads and buildings to provide a topographic map. Topographic cross sections created from the DEM generally agree with sections surveyed with a hand level and a measurement tape. The obtained DEM and map are useful for preliminary field research.  相似文献

One can easily use nineteenth-century tithe data of England and Wales in a Geographic Information System (GIS) to analyze a range of subjects, for example, land use, productivity, land ownership, or tenancy. Making the tithe data GIS ready, on the other hand, is a nontrivial matter. The tithe data consist of two main types: spatial, that is, the tithe map, and nonspatial attribute data linked to the map. The tithe therefore has the characteristics of a GIS, albeit in paper form. The author outlines the process of creating the structures for building a data repository that allows the storage and dissemination of both tithe schedules and maps in a single GIS-ready system. The author chose Oracle to host the repository. The Oracle Spatial module allows storage of both spatial and attribute information. Oracle also provides the means of serving data to users via the Internet.  相似文献

Situated along the southern fringe of the North Sea basin, northwest Belgium holds great potential for understanding hunter–gatherer responses to environmental change at the Pleistocene–Holocene transition. Recent intensive fieldwork has yielded valuable data on the palaeoenvironment, chronology, and hunter–gatherer mobility and land use in this region. At the Late Glacial/Early Holocene transition this region was comprised of a landscape of coversand ridges and lakes that flanked the northern part of the Scheldt river basin. This landscape was highly productive for hunter–gatherer populations. As the landscape developed in response to the increasing water table caused by the inundation of the North Sea populations responded by changing their forms of mobility and land use. These changes are indicated by the reduction in the number and density of sites, as well as their geographical settings, from the Late Glacial (Federmesser) and Early Mesolithic to the Middle-Final Mesolithic. Late Glacial/Early Mesolithic sites indicate much higher mobility comprised of rapid displacements of camps and re-occupation of the same coversand ridges over long time-spans. Middle/Late Mesolithic sites indicate a reduction in mobility, increasing focus on prolonged riverside settlement, and a more rigid organization of residential sites.  相似文献
